Doing JPL5 in Other Numbers of Colors

I strongly, strongly, strongly recommend learning JPL5 with 5 colors. Once you are comfortable weaving in 5 colors, you can try doing JPL5 in 2 or 3 (or any other number) of colors. The PDF tutorial includes a “quick start” chart that shows steps 1-19 in 2-, 3-, 4- and 6-colors. Check out how the chart works:

Fraud email from company with similar name

graphic that shows a cell phone on the left open to an email of an order confirmation. The text on the right reads: SCAM ALERT - THIS IS NOT ME If you receive an order confirmation from "bluebuddhaboutique" via "commentsold" for something you did not order, this is NOT my company

If you received an order confirmation about an order you did NOT place, and the order is via commentsold on Facebook, that message is spam. It is also not my company (I’ve never sold through commentsold), but likely instead refers to another clothing company with an identical name.

I recommend checking your bank account to confirm no charges are processing, and also contacting commentsold – [email protected] – to report the issue.  (You can see their response to my inquiry below)

The other company that started doing business as “The Blue Buddha Boutique” does sell through commentsold, so you may wish to reach out to them. (I did contact them but have not received a response. As of the writing of this post, the contact form on their website is broken, but you may still be able to reach them on Facebook). Their info:
